As most Bengal cats, Roxy formed an unbreakable bond with her human parents and simply adores being at the center of the attention. The care and affection of her family is rewarded with fierce loyalty and unconditional love. When a Bengal bonds with a family, it’s a bond like no other. Some people are afraid that the complete commitment and devotion of Bengal cats might mean that they won’t be as friendly or trusting when it comes to people outside their family. But, if they have the opportunity to meet different people from an early age, they’ll make some room in their hearts for your close friends, as well.

Roxy is very chatty, too, and frequently answers back when talked to- with a variety of meowing, mewing and trilling sounds. Bengal cats are well-known for amusing conversations they tend to lead with their humans, so it doesn’t come as a surprise that Roxy is rarely silent. Since they are highly intelligent and athletic, Bengal cats are always looking for a new challenge. They are the completely opposite of the lazy, sleepy cat stereotype. They tend to be very active, and love to play and climb all over, and Roxy’s no exception. When she’s not playing “football” with Robert or joining him for a walk or a run around the neighborhood, she spends her afternoons curled up on his lap, enjoying their time together. In those precious moments when a Bengal cat is not on an adventure, you can enjoy their tender, warmhearted side, and all the cuddles and the purring that comes with it.
